Job Description

**Position Summary:** Responsible for creative development, preparation, and production of a wide range of sports content, including segments, highlights, teases & bumps, and other content from start to finish for air to reach viewers and increase ESPN's market penetration, rating and viewership across multiple platforms. This position will focus primarily on NBA/WNBA studio productions and other studio productions as assigned. **Responsibilities:** + In coordination with the assigned senior production staff (e.g. Producer, Coordinating Producers), identifies and develops content that interprets, enhances and reinforces the concepts of sports content to tell stories. + Oversees production of content from start to finish, including: + Leads a team of production staff (e.g. APs, CAs, PAs) to conceive of, plan and execute the production of highlights, teases, bumps, segments, etc. + Uses mastery of sports knowledge, creativity and news judgment to research, generate, select & pitch concepts and content ideas. + Evaluates & influences the style and story lines of content. Guides staff in topic selection, highlight development, writing, sound & shot selection. + Coordinates with the production staff to write accurate and informative content (e.g. teases & bumps, shot sheets, scripts). + Oversees & influences editing associated with the content to ensure desired story line and pacing. + Arranges and schedules content components (e.g. talent, graphics, animations, and edit time). + Coordinates with technical staff to maximize the technical process & tools with which content is created and delivered to fans across multiple platforms to best tell a story. + Adjusts content to accommodate breaking news situations and changing storylines. + Provides final review of content to ensure quality and accuracy. + Leadership responsibilities: + Effectively maintains leadership in a group environment; maintains professional relationships within the production staff to ensure professionalism, teamwork and objective reporting. + Oversees direct reports, solicits & delivers feedback in a timely manner. + Trains, coaches, develops and mentors production staff on idea generation, communication, edit room performance, and overall quality & accuracy of content production. + Includes a diverse set of viewpoints and experiences through the planning and execution of content. + May occasionally produce entire programs with guidance from the responsible leader (e.g. Producer, Coordinating Producer, etc.). **Qualifications:** + Minimum of 5-years of progressively complex production experience with an emphasis on sports content. + Solid ability to interpret sports stories and to create and assemble compelling content to support the concept of the story. + Strong knowledge of real-time sports production processes and working knowledge of equipment and all relevant technologies used to carry out a broad range of assignments. + Must have detailed knowledge of what "works" across multiple platforms and what is realistic to accomplish in time allotted. + Good editorial judgement. + Good understanding of people supervision, the development of teams and leadership skills. + Strong organizational, time management, and communication skills. + Good content interpretation skills related to sporting events. + Good appreciation of popular culture, and understands the tastes of ESPN's consumers. + Good understanding of ESPN's market positioning and strategies. + Has an established knowledge of sports and sports history. + Strong working knowledge of production workflows. + Availability to work nights/weekends/holidays as required. **Required Education:** High School Diploma **Preferred Education:** Bachelor's Degree **Additional Information:** (i.e. physical requirements, holiday, nights, weekend shifts, etc.) \#ESPNMedia The hiring range for this position in Los Angeles, CA and Bristol, CT is $85,800 to $115,000 per year based on a 40 hour work week. The amount of hours scheduled per week may vary based on business needs.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ate's ge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ors.
